Wendy Johnson

Wendy Johnson is a muralist and artist from Bakersfield, California, whose work is deeply inspired by the natural world and the landscapes of the Central Valley. Her art reflects a love of sunlight, native plants, and organic forms, blending bold color with a sense of calm and connection to the earth. Circles often appear throughout her work, symbolizing the repetition and honor that go into the creative process—each layer and movement reflecting dedication, rhythm, and intention. Through her murals, Wendy transforms public spaces into reflections of harmony and belonging, inviting viewers to slow down and reconnect with the world around them.


Her recent public art projects, including large-scale murals for CalTrans and the City of Bakersfield, were supported by grants from the Arts Council of Kern, the California Arts Council, California State Parks, and Parks California. Wendy’s work has been exhibited at Bird Dog Arts and the Bakersfield Art Association. Grounded in her roots and inspired by the beauty around her, Wendy continues to create art that uplifts and celebrates the natural rhythms of life.
